Question

An unbiased die with faces marked 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, and 6 is rolled four times. Out of four face values obtained, the probability that the minimum face value is not less than 2 and the maximum face value is not greater than 5 is

Options

A.$\frac{16}{81}$
B.$\frac{1}{81}$
C.$\frac{80}{81}$
D.$\frac{65}{81}$

Solution

{"given":"An unbiased die with faces 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6 is rolled four times. We need to find the probability that all four outcomes have minimum value ≥ 2 and maximum value ≤ 5.","key_observation":"For the condition to be satisfied, each of the four rolls must result in a face value from the set {2, 3, 4, 5}. Since the rolls are independent events, we can use the multiplication principle. The favorable outcomes per roll are 4 out of 6 possible outcomes.","option_analysis":[{"label":"(A)","text":"$\\frac{16}{81}$","verdict":"correct","explanation":"Each roll must be from {2,3,4,5}, giving probability $\\frac{4}{6} = \\frac{2}{3}$ per roll. For four independent rolls: $\\left(\\frac{2}{3}\\right)^4 = \\frac{16}{81}$."},{"label":"(B)","text":"$\\frac{1}{81}$","verdict":"incorrect","explanation":"This would correspond to $\\left(\\frac{1}{3}\\right)^4$, which is too restrictive.
